There was a Lutheran church that had to remain standing underneath it; therefore, Citicorp had to build above it.
The stilts had to be placed in the middle, which wasn't structurally "ideal", then there was a chevron shaped structure used to balance the building and acted as a skeleton. Overall the building is incredibly light and many worry it could topple over in a heavy windstorm.
A student, Diane Lee Hartley tried to publicize this after finding a flaw in the design.
